#dda878 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#dda878 is composed of 86.7% red, 65.9% green and 47.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 24% magenta, 45.7% yellow and 13.3% black. It has a hue angle of 28.5 degrees, a saturation of 59.8% and a lightness of 66.9%. #dda878 color hex could be obtained by blending #fffff0 with #bb5100. Closest websafe color is: #cc9966.

#dda878 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#dda878 has RGB values of R:221, G:168, B:120 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.24, Y:0.46, K:0.13. Its decimal value is 14526584.

Shades and Tints of #dda878
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060402 is the darkest color, while #fdf9f5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#dda878
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b0aaa6 is the less saturated color, while #fea658 is the most saturated one.
